I'm having success reading the Chargery real-time data using a simple UBS interface with just RX/TX ports on a Pi 4 running Raspian. I just connect to the /dev/ttyUSB0 interface at 115200 baud and collect the stats as a datastream. I parse it using some basic Linux tools and feed it to a python...

Jason at Chargery just shipped me one of the new 16P BMS units. The big changes are:
1amp Balancing (now the control unit is black (slightly larger) and has a fan inside
Screen showing Internal resistance of the cells
Balancing action is shown on the main screen using a yellow bar icon.

Hi, I have 4 BYD packs, this is what happens.
Below is a chart of the individual cell voltages as the aggregate voltage
limit is reached. You can see that the most worn cells start rapidly increasing their voltages, much faster than the healthy cells.

I just hooked up my BMS8T. I used the connector on the original defunct BMS that came with the BYD. Cut the connector off the motherboard and soldered on the Chargery wire. Works great, no need to order any extra cables or connectors. Protect the delicate wires with a big blob from a glue gun.
